Buffavento Castle

1Buffavento Castle

📖 Type: Byzantine‑Frankish Mountain Fortress

  • 🏯 Built on a rocky peak in the Kyrenia Mountains (11th–14th c.)
  • 🛡️ Part of trio with St. Hilarion & Kantara, used for signal defense
  • ⛓️ Functioned as a prison during Lusignan rule in the 14th century
  • 🌬️ Name means “Defier of the Winds” — perched at ~950 m altitude
  • 🎨 Combines rugged Byzantine foundations with Lusignan/Frankish additions
  • 📸 Stunning views of Kyrenia coast, Mesaoria plain, Taurus Mountains

Kyrenia Castle

3Kyrenia Castle

📖 Type: Castle

  • 🏯 16th-century Venetian fortress
  • 🧱 Built on Byzantine foundations
  • ⚓ Overlooks Kyrenia harbor
  • 📷 Includes Shipwreck Museum
  • 🚢 Houses 4th-century BC Greek ship
  • ⛪ Small chapel inside

Saint Hilarion Castle

6Saint Hilarion Castle

📖 Type: Medieval Castle

  • 🏯 Built in the 10th century as a Byzantine monastery, later fortified
  • 🌄 Stunning views over Kyrenia and the coast
  • 🧭 Famous for inspiring Disney’s Sleeping Beauty castle
  • 🚶 Steep paths and steps – good footwear recommended

Malatya Waterfall

7Malatya Waterfall

📖 Type: Natural Waterfall (Seasonal)

  • 🏞️ A charming, tiered waterfall nestled in a lush canyon 
  • 🚶 Often visited via a scenic hiking route from St Hilarion Castle through Karmi village
  • 🌿 Flows mainly during the rainy season (December to April);
  • 🌊 Features mossy cliffs and calm pools — ideal for nature lovers
